var g_i;
var AnchoAux;
var AltoAux;
var newimg = new Image; 
function Ant(){
	if (g_i==1){
		g_i=aFotos.length-1;
	}else{
		g_i=g_i-1;
	}
	document.all.sImagen.innerHTML='<img src="'+DimeImagen()+'">';
}
function Sig(){
	if(g_i==aFotos.length-1){
		g_i=1;
	}else{
		g_i=g_i+1;
	}
	document.all.sImagen.innerHTML='<img src="'+DimeImagen()+'">';
}

function getScrollXY() {
  var scrOfX = 0, scrOfY = 0;
  if( typeof( window.pageYOffset ) == 'number' ) {
    //Netscape compliant
    scrOfY = window.pageYOffset;
    scrOfX = window.pageXOffset;
  } else if( document.body && ( document.body.scrollLeft || document.body.scrollTop ) ) {
    //DOM compliant
    scrOfY = document.body.scrollTop;
    scrOfX = document.body.scrollLeft;
  } else if( document.documentElement && ( document.documentElement.scrollLeft || document.documentElement.scrollTop ) ) {
    //IE6 standards compliant mode
    scrOfY = document.documentElement.scrollTop;
    scrOfX = document.documentElement.scrollLeft;
  }
  return scrOfY;
  //return [ scrOfX, scrOfY ];
}

function evt_keyPress (e) {
	var evento = e || window.event;
	
	var caracter = evento.charCode || evento.keyCode;
	var key = String.fromCharCode(caracter).toLowerCase();
	  
	switch(key){
	case 'x':
		Cerrar();break;
	case 'a':
		Ant();break;
	case 's':
		Sig();break;
	}
}

function DimeImagen(){
	newimg.src = DirFotos+'/Copia de '+aFotos[g_i];
	return DirFotos+'/Copia de '+aFotos[g_i];
}

function MostrarImg(Foto){
	//Obtener el i
	for (k=0;k<aFotos.length;k++){
		if (aFotos[k]==Foto){i=k;}
	}
	g_i=i;
	var x, y;
	
	// for all except Explorer
	if (self.innerHeight) {
		x = self.innerWidth-18;
		y = self.innerHeight;
		
		// Explorer 6 Strict Mode
	} else if (document.documentElement
		&& document.documentElement.clientHeight) {
		x = document.documentElement.clientWidth;
		y = document.documentElement.clientHeight;
		
		// other Explorers
		} else if (document.body) {
		x = document.body.clientWidth;
		y = document.body.clientHeight;
	}
	document.all.sImagen.innerHTML='<img src="'+DimeImagen()+'">';
	document.all.dFoto.style.width=x;document.all.dFoto2.style.width=x;
	document.all.dFoto.style.height=3000;document.all.dFoto2.style.height=3000;
	document.all.dFoto.style.display="block";
	document.all.dFoto2.style.top=20+getScrollXY();
	document.all.dFoto2.style.display="block";
}
function Cerrar(){
	document.all.dFoto.style.display='none';
	document.all.dFoto2.style.display='none';
}
document.onkeypress = evt_keyPress;